No traffic road cycling routes around Kaisten are set within the varied landscapes of the Jurapark Aargau, characterized by rolling hills, lush meadows, and vineyards. The region features a stepped landscape with sparse forests of the Tafeljura and Kettenjura. Cyclists will encounter both flat sections along the Rhine river and more challenging hilly terrain in the Jura, offering diverse riding experiences. The area provides a compelling mix of natural beauty and cultural highlights for road cyclists.

  • The most popular no traffic road cycling route is Schloss Beuggen – Bad Säckingen Old Town loop from Bad Säckingen, a 28.6 miles (46.0 km) trail that takes 2 hours 10 minutes to complete. This moderate route features a mix of riverside paths and gentle climbs.
  • Another top favourite among local road cyclists is Bad Säckingen Old Town – Car-Free Route Hasel–Wehr loop from Bad Säckingen, a moderate 23.4 miles (37.6 km) path. This route offers scenic views through varied terrain, including car-free sections.
  • Local road cyclists also love the Rhine Cycle Path near Schwörstadt – Bad Säckingen Old Town loop from Bad Säckingen, a 15.4 miles (24.8 km) trail leading through the Rhine river valley, often completed in about 1 hour.
  • Road cycling around Kaisten is defined by the Rhine river, rolling Jura hills, and cultivated landscapes with orchards. The network offers options for various ability levels, from easy riverside rides to more challenging routes with significant elevation gains.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many no-traffic road cycling routes can I find around Kaisten?

There are over 25 dedicated no-traffic road cycling routes around Kaisten. These routes offer a mix of difficulties, with 4 easy, 20 moderate, and 1 difficult option, ensuring there's something for every skill level.

Are there any easy, traffic-free road cycling routes suitable for beginners or families in Kaisten?

Yes, Kaisten offers several easy, traffic-free road cycling routes perfect for beginners or families. These routes often follow the flat to rolling sections along the Rhine river, providing scenic and relaxed rides. You can find 4 easy routes in the area, designed for a comfortable experience away from vehicle traffic.

What kind of terrain can I expect on the no-traffic road cycling routes around Kaisten?

The terrain around Kaisten is quite varied. You'll find flat to rolling sections, especially along the Rhine, which are ideal for relaxed rides. However, many routes also venture into the hilly Jura landscape, featuring significant elevation gains and 'ups and downs' typical of the region. While most routes are well-paved, some moderate and difficult options might include short unpaved segments.

Are there any circular no-traffic road cycling routes around Kaisten?

Yes, many of the no-traffic road cycling routes around Kaisten are designed as circular loops, allowing you to start and end at the same point. An example is the Bad Säckingen Old Town – Car-Free Route Hasel–Wehr loop from Bad Säckingen, which offers a moderate ride through varied landscapes.

What are some scenic viewpoints or natural features I can expect along these routes?

The Kaisten region, nestled within Jurapark Aargau, offers stunning natural beauty. Many routes provide panoramic vistas of the Swiss Alps and the Black Forest, especially from higher points like Wasserflue. You'll also cycle through lush meadows, vineyards, orchards, and sparse forests of the Tafeljura and Kettenjura. The Rhine river itself is a prominent feature, with routes running alongside its banks.

What cultural or historical attractions can I visit while on a no-traffic road cycling tour?

The region is rich in cultural and historical sites. You can cycle past the historical Wieladingen Castle Ruins or explore the charming Laufenburg Old Town and its Rhine Bridge. Other notable attractions include the Wooden Covered Bridge in Bad Säckingen, various churches, and the Lourdes Chapel. For nature enthusiasts, the Heuberg Forest Nature Trail is also accessible.

What is the best season for no-traffic road biking around Kaisten?

The spring, summer, and autumn months generally offer the best conditions for no-traffic road biking around Kaisten. During these seasons, the weather is typically pleasant, and the natural landscapes, including orchards with apple, pear, and cherry trees, are at their most vibrant. Always check local weather forecasts before heading out.

Can I find any caves or unique geological features along the routes?

Yes, the region around Kaisten features several interesting caves and rock formations. While cycling, you might be near highlights such as the Brother's Cave, the Schwaderloch Rock Grotto, or the Kornberg Rock Cavern, offering unique geological sights to explore.
